Outplacement services are typically offered by third-party firms hired by companies to provide support to outgoing employees. These services often include career coaching, resume writing, job search assistance, interview preparation, and networking opportunities. The goal of outplacement service is to help displaced workers land new jobs quickly and efficiently while minimizing the emotional and financial impact of job loss.
One of the key benefits of outplacement service is that it provides a structured support system for employees during a time of transition. Losing a job can be a traumatic experience, and having access to professional guidance and resources can make the process less overwhelming. Outplacement services help individuals navigate the job market, identify their skills and strengths, and develop a strategic plan for finding new employment.
Moreover, outplacement services can help individuals improve their resume and cover letter writing skills, enhance their interviewing techniques, and build a strong personal brand. These services are invaluable in today’s competitive job market, where standing out from the crowd is essential to securing a new position.
For employers, offering outplacement services to displaced employees can also bring a range of benefits. Providing outplacement support demonstrates a commitment to caring for employees’ well-being, even during difficult times. This can help boost morale, enhance company reputation, and reduce the risk of legal challenges from disgruntled former employees.
Furthermore, outplacement services can help employers protect their brand and maintain positive relationships with both current and former employees. By offering support to departing employees, organizations can ensure a smooth transition process and preserve goodwill within the workforce.
Outplacement services also serve as a valuable tool for companies looking to manage downsizing or restructuring efforts efficiently. By providing outplacement support to displaced workers, employers can help minimize disruptions to the business, maintain productivity, and avoid negative publicity associated with layoffs.
